--- OBJECTIVE:
--- Check that the function Valid with Byte_Array and Binary_Format
--- parameters returns True if the Byte_Array parameter corresponds
--- to any value inside the range of type Num.
--- Check that function Valid returns False if the Byte_Array parameter
--- corresponds to a value outside the range of Num.
---
--- Check that function Length with Binary_Format parameter will return
--- the minimum length of a Byte_Array value required to hold any value
--- of decimal type Num.
---
--- Check that function To_Decimal with Byte_Array and Binary_Format
--- parameters will return a decimal type value that corresponds to
--- parameter Item (of type Byte_Array) under the specified Format.
---
--- Check that Conversion_Error is propagated by function To_Decimal if
--- the Byte_Array parameter Item represents a decimal value outside the
--- range of decimal type Num.
---
--- Check that function To_Binary will produce a Byte_Array result that
--- corresponds to the decimal type parameter Item, under the specified
--- Binary_Format.
---
--- TEST DESCRIPTION:
--- This test uses several instantiations of generic package
--- Decimal_Conversions to provide appropriate test material.
--- This test uses the function To_Binary to create all Byte_Array
--- parameter values used in calls to functions Valid and To_Decimal.
--- The function Valid is tested with parameters to provide both
--- valid and invalid expected results. This test also checks that
--- Function To_Decimal produces expected results in cases where each
--- of the three predefined Binary_Format constants are used in the
--- function calls. In addition, the prescribed propagation of
--- Conversion_Error by function To_Decimal is verified.
---
--- APPLICABILITY CRITERIA:
--- This test is applicable to all implementations that provide
--- package Interfaces.COBOL. If an implementation provides
--- package Interfaces.COBOL, this test must compile, execute, and
--- report "PASSED".
